    Best gathering job for money?

    Hello. So I\\'m mainly a fighter, but these days a lala just can\\'t get by on fights alone.

    So. I\\'ve decided to dabble in gathering. (as I absolutely detect crafting)

    Which of the 3 gathering jobs is seen as a money maker, and how?

    All three have their merits.
    Botany has logs, seeds for gardening that sell fast. Mining has ore, soil for gardening. Fishing has, well, fish.

    However, fishing does not have 'unspoiled nodes' nor can you gather shards/crystals/clusters. Miner and botanist get the special nodes that let's them gather certain special items like grade 3 Thanalan/Shroud/La Noscean soil and so on.
    If you level both, you can follow the 'cycle of gil' as some people I know call it. Meaning, you just go from node to node to node.

    I think mining is probably more profitable in the long run, but it can get very boring very fast.

    I use my miner to farm up ores for my goldsmith, and in turn process those ores into ingots and the ingots into jewelry. By doing it all myself, I turn a couple of rocks valued at 300-500 gil each into HQ items I can sell for 50 times that in some cases.

    However, there's a huge market for the raw ores for the crafters who are too lazy to go pick at rocks themselves. Silver, mythril, electrum, and cobalt will all fetch a pretty penny for the effort.

    Either miner or botanist, doesn't matter which. The bulk of your gil will come from shards crystals and clusters. The vast majority of unspoiled nodes aren't worth the time and effort to go for.

    Miner. Besides the ore (which has a much larger market than logs) it has more cluster spawns than botanist. And the * mats are generally more used for min as well.

    Having both is better, though, as you can hit all the nodes then.

    One thing I've noticed about fishing is that you can't completely target the money earners. There's an element of randomness that cannot be removed. But for mining and botany, as long as you have the right gear, you can get 100% success on your designated item.

    Also there are a lot of trash fish only good for leveling desynth (part of crafting) it seems. So if you must choose one, don't choose Fishing.

    Miner and botanist are about even, with neither REALLY being more profitable than the other.
    Fisher actually has things that are worth more actual money, with some fish worth hundreds of thousands of gil, but the trade-off is you're COMPLETELY at the mercy of the RNG for fishing, and your inventory space will be at a premium.
